トップ «前の日記(2004-06-24) 最新 次の日記(2004-06-26)» 編集

muneda's diary


2004-06-25 曇り,激霧,メガネも曇るっちゅうねん [長年日記]

_1 Subversion の導入メモ

Subversionのインストール

emerge dev-util/subversion

/etc/apache2/conf/modules.d/47_mod_dav_svn.conf の修正

修正は以下の2点

-SVNPath /var/www/htdocs/svn/repos
+SVNPath /home/svn/repos

-AuthUserFile /var/www/htdocs/svn/conf/svnusers
+AuthUserFile /home/svn/conf/svnusers

パスワードファイルの作成

# mkdir -p /home/svn/conf
# /usr/sbin/htpasswd2 -c /home/svn/conf/svnusers $USER
# chown apache:apache /home/svn/conf/svnusers

リポジトリの作成

# svnadmin create /home/svn/repos
# chown -R apache:apache /home/svn/repos
# chmod 700 /hoemsvn/repos

ファイルの取得

$ mkdir hoge; cd hoge
$ svn co http://SVN_SERVER_URI/svn/repos

ファイルの作成 + バージョン管理対象化

$ mkdir foo
$ nano foo/bar.txt
$ svn add foo

Commit

$ svn ci

ファイルの確認

ブラウザで http://SVN_SERVER_URI/svn/repos を見る

ファイルが正しく見えたのでよし.異なるリビジョンで diff を取ったりもできてウマー.共有マシンにも入れたいけど管理権がないねんなこれが.違うわ,共有マシンから自分のマシンに向かって利用すればいいやんか.月曜はぜひそれを試してみよう.

Tags: Gentoo Linux

_2 読書

Code Reading―オープンソースから学ぶソフトウェア開発技法(トップスタジオ/まつもと ゆきひろ/平林 俊一/鵜飼 文敏)

会社の図書館から借りてきた.新刊なので貸し出し期間は1週間のみ.返却期限は20040702.

やっとカバーの裏のナゾが解けた.そういうことね.おーい,図書館の人,シールでカバーを閉じたら読まれへんやんか.


過去の日記
2002|05|06|07|08|09|10|11|12|
2003|01|02|03|04|05|06|07|08|09|10|11|12|
2004|01|02|03|04|05|06|07|08|09|10|11|12|
2005|01|02|03|04|05|06|07|08|09|10|11|12|
2006|01|02|03|04|05|06|07|08|09|10|11|12|
2007|01|02|03|04|05|06|07|08|09|10|11|12|
2008|01|02|03|04|05|06|07|08|09|10|11|12|
2009|01|02|03|04|05|06|07|08|09|10|11|12|
2010|01|02|03|04|05|06|07|08|09|10|11|12|
2011|01|02|03|04|05|06|07|08|09|10|11|12|
2012|01|02|03|04|05|06|07|08|09|10|11|12|
2013|01|02|03|04|05|06|07|08|09|10|11|12|
2014|01|02|03|04|05|06|07|08|09|10|11|12|
2015|01|02|03|05|06|
トップ «前の日記(2004-06-24) 最新 次の日記(2004-06-26)» 編集